Transaction 41a8bc498da358214c72195c93ba1bdab0fa07fa5c474f2ec3771bbe5c1e327d

1 Input
2 Outputs
  • 41a8bc498da358214c72195c93ba1bdab0fa07fa5c474f2ec3771bbe5c1e327d:0
  • value  333629
    address  34xzgd5xhvcquxD5bKPGRPvpXkT1S9uLqH
  • 41a8bc498da358214c72195c93ba1bdab0fa07fa5c474f2ec3771bbe5c1e327d:1
  • value  18744051
    address  1ERsWacNLXyaR9M6JdPPsFqAbdPpqqFc4o